Tile Roofing - Barrel and Flat Concrete

Barrel tile dominates Miami streetscapes from Shenandoah to Coconut Grove. It looks right, but it’s heavy and unforgiving when installed with cheap hardware. In West Little Havana, we stripped a 1960s CBS house where every original electroplated screw had turned to rust powder after thirty years of salt air. Tiles lifted in every afternoon thunderstorm. We reset that roof with stainless one-coat screws over a self-adhered high-temp underlayment, the same standard we use on Window Installation - Miami jobs. If your tile roof predates Hurricane Andrew, it likely needs a fastener audit, not a quick patch.

Metal Roofing - Standing Seam and 5V Crimp

Standing seam metal roofs are booming in Miami’s Design District and Buena Vista because they shrug off wind uplift when detailed correctly. The catch: at the eave and rake edge, where salt fog condenses and runs down inside the trim, a galvanized butt strap fails in about five years. We spec stainless there. Every time. It costs a few hundred dollars more and adds decades to the roof’s life.

Shingle Roofing - Architectural Asphalt

Architectural asphalt shingles remain the most budget-friendly full replacement for Miami homeowners in Kendall and Westchester. The right install for this climate means a full self-adhered underlayment over the deck, six nails per shingle, and hand-sealed starter courses. Wind-driven rain from a June squall finds every shortcut. We don’t give it a path.

Common Shingle, Tile & Metal Roofing Problems We See in Miami Homes

  • Rust-jacked tile fasteners. Electroplated screws corrode in salt air, swell, and lift tiles off the deck. Once lifted, wind-driven rain gets under the underlayment and starts rotting the plywood from the top down.
  • Metal roof oil-canning at the eave. When a cheaper crew swaps stainless butt straps for galvanized to save $300, the seam separates within five years. You’ll see it as a wavy line of buckling right above the gutter, usually after the first strong afternoon storm.
  • Underlayment breakdown at the gable end. Salt fog condenses inside the rake trim and runs down, soaking the deck edge. The shingles or tiles up top look fine while the deck underneath turns soft. We catch this during inspections, not after a ceiling stain appears.
  • Jalousie-era window flashing failures. Many Miami CBS homes built through the 1970s still carry original jalousie windows. The rough opening flashing around them leaks into the roof-wall joint. When we reroof, we inspect that intersection and fix the flashing before new roofing goes down.

Pricing for Shingle, Tile & Metal Roofing in Miami, FL

Here’s what you’re looking at in Miami’s actual market. Architectural shingle roofs run $9,500 to $16,000 on a typical 1,600-square-foot CBS home with a clean deck. Barrel tile runs $18,000 to $28,000 because the material weighs more and the underlayment spec is stricter. Standing seam metal runs $16,000 to $26,000, with the lower end reflecting 5V crimp panels and the upper end true standing seam with stainless edge details. If your deck has soft spots, add $1,500 to $4,000 for sheathing replacement. Every quote includes the full HVHZ fastener schedule, no shortcuts. Florida Pays You Back

That’s the one part of the roofing conversation that doesn’t hurt. My Safe Florida Home offers matching grants up to $10,000 for qualifying wind-mitigation upgrades, and Miami homeowners qualify based on the home’s wind zone location. Florida also exempts impact-resistant windows and Door Installation - Miami from sales tax, and the federal 25C energy credit can return up to $600 per year on qualifying units. After a wind-mitigation inspection, typically $75 to $150, many Miami homeowners see windstorm premium credits averaging about 25% on the windstorm line. No guarantees; your carrier sets the final number. But the stack is there, and we’ll point you to the right forms.
